#b44950 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b44950 is composed of 70.6% red, 28.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 59.4% magenta, 55.6%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 356.1 degrees, a saturation of 42.3% and a lightness of 49.6%. #b44950 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92a0 with #690000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3366.

● #b44950 color description : Moderate red.
#b44950 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b44950 has RGB values of R:180, G:73,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.59, Y:0.56,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11815248.

Shades and Tints of #b44950
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0506 is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b44950
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#837a7a is the less saturated color, while #f80515 is the most saturated one.
